Is there a way to migrate, or import bookmarks from Firefox to Safari?

| I have read that Safari RSS supports HTML pages containing a list of bookmarks. Cool enough, this is how Firefox stores its bookmarks. You should be able to find this .html file in Firefox's directories and then import it into Safari. I don't know the exact steps because I only have Panther on my Mac, but hope that helps. |
